Chapter VIII: Criteria & Validity. (Wiggins & McTighe , 2005)

As we have been studying the book “Understanding by Design” by the authors mentioned above, we have been realizing, step by step, the different elements and key concepts that undoubtedly have become really important to our own awareness of evaluation and assessment.
In this chapter called “Criteria and Validity”, the authors discuss and give lots of tips about how we as teachers have to be aware of the importance of different types of assessment, specifically the ones which are not based just in correct or incorrect answers (objective tests), but the ones which the evaluation is guided by an appropriate criteria. This brings the question that at the moment of having evaluations based on students’ performances, in what criteria do teachers support these evaluations? This is a huge subject because is not that easy for an assessor to test and assess according to what he thinks is correct or not. The things is that in order to assess students’ understanding is central to have criteria and formulate rubrics for its further assessment. By rubrics we mean a set of instructions where an assessor relies on and supports the evaluation. At the same time, rubrics describe degrees of quality, proficiency or understanding along a continuum (Wiggins & McTighe, 2005). According to the authors there exist two general types of rubrics: holistic and analytic. The holistic one is intended to evaluate a general view of a task, in opposition to the analytical one which is based on particular areas or “traits” that gives different scores in different areas.

Understanding by Design

In order to make a critical discussion of the chapter 2 “Understanding Understanding” from the Book “Understanding by Design” by Wiggins & Mctighe, we have to look at 3 different but connected ideas that the chapter gives us.

First, we have to look and examine the concept of understanding. The discussion starts, paradoxically, on the lack of understanding of this concept. According to the authors this concept is frequently misunderstood or confounded with the idea of Knowledge. This misinterpretations, which are made by teachers and people regarding to the area of Education, have undesirable consequences when assessment appears. That is to say that at the moment of testing is important to know if this process has a connection with the content knowledge or skills that should be tested (Validity). So, the assessment a teacher does is going to depend on the understanding he or she has from the concepts of Understanding and Knowledge.

Now, it is important to define these two concepts. From Understanding, what we obtain is the abstraction, the mental process that human minds do in order to “get the idea”, to understand and give meaning and sense to different and connected parts of knowledge. At the same time, Understanding has to do with knowing something and being capable of use that knowledge so that he or she is able to use that information for certain things.
On the other hand, Knowledge is defined by the facts and information we obtain from a subject or experience.
